There is precedent for a permanent ban. Marty McSorley was suspended indefinitely by the NHL for a 2000 incident when he slashed Donald Brashear in the head with his stick which resulted in Brashear receiving a grade 3 concussion. He was also charged and convicted of assault with a deadly weapon. He received a year long suspension after his conviction which essentially ended his hockey career. Subsequently, most North American minor leagues, and all the European professional leagues decided to uphold the NHL's suspension and did not allow him to play for any of their respective teams (edit: exception being Grand Rapids in 2001 for a handful of games).

Rudolph has a case to be made if he wanted to file assault charges. I'm pretty sure I would. What transpired was completely outside the scope of a football game.
